Xcodes

June 6th, 2013

Registration

First, please register for an apple developer account in order to download some useful Xcodes programs.

Installations

Please download and install Xcode 4.6 (released on Feb 20 2013) from the Apple website:
https://developer.apple.com/downloads/index.action?name=Xcode
Sample codes can be downloaded from the Apple website:
http://developer.apple.com/library/ios/navigation/#section=Resource%20Types&topic=Sample%20Code
Among the various example Xcodes provided by Apple, the following are
useful for MAP related App development:
iOS/Breadcrumb
iOS/KMLViewer
The explanations/documentations  are provided at their website, only available to you
after you login using your Apple ID.

Tutorials

There are many Xcodes related online tutorials available. I would recommend you to have a look at them and try out some of the examples.
Basic tutorial:
http://www.youtube.com/watch?v=pD4v4g3ycBA&NR=1
(see earlier lessons as well)
Mapview
http://www.youtube.com/watch?v=J5S7qVFVjQo&feature=related
http://www.youtube.com/user/vivianaranha#p/c/7F0BF65DB4D3828E/24/X-3jM24EIGM
Moving buttons:
http://www.youtube.com/watch?v=JQeUQu3pyDQ&NR=1
Drag ball
http://www.youtube.com/watch?v=HM36nS_JbcY
Add icon
http://www.youtube.com/watch?v=9QTdFjc2jjQ&NR=1
Add number to icon
http://www.youtube.com/watch?v=1M-zgBXHqXw
Default screen
http://www.youtube.com/watch?v=pQwFLaAv5Zs&NR=1
Background + table
http://www.youtube.com/watch?v=KgtltU5Wfe0&feature=related
Switch view
http://www.youtube.com/watch?v=uUmukNqEAoc&feature=related
http://www.youtube.com/watch?v=HaAPa3gIwMY&feature=related
http://www.youtube.com/watch?v=oDR1TsmFObg&feature=related
http://www.youtube.com/watch?v=51u-Eu5JUr8&feature=related
Image picker
http://www.youtube.com/watch?v=x7J0Gmxi_rM&feature=related
Table view controller
http://www.youtube.com/watch?v=qBGLj158dxY&feature=related
http://www.youtube.com/watch?v=JGMa3eLGxXQ&NR=1
Navigation controller
http://www.youtube.com/user/vivianaranha#p/c/7F0BF65DB4D3828E/11/odk-rr_mzUo

Comments are closed.